2021 MILLAGE RATES BY TAXING AUTHORITY
SUWANNEE RIVER WATER MANAGEMENT0.3615
SCHOOL BOARD-INCLUDING LRE AND DISCRETIONARY5.8910
LAKE SHORE HOSPITAL0.0000
BOARD OF COUNTY COMMISSIONERS7.8150
CITY OF LAKE CITY4.9000
TOTAL MILLAGE RATE FOR COUNTY14.0676
TOTAL MILLAGE RATE FOR COUNTY AND CITY OF LAKE CITY18.9675

MILLAGE RATE INFORMATION

Taxing authorities levy annual taxes on the taxable property in their jurisdictions. The rate at which a taxing authority levies tax is usually expressed in mils. One mil represents a rate of .001, and can be confusing if millage is confused with millage rate. The easiest way to think of millage is in “dollars per thousand”; that is, a rate of one mil is equal to one dollar of tax for each 1000 dollars of taxable value. The following example may be helpful.

If a taxing authority levies 10 mils on $1000 of taxable value… *The millage levy would be expressed as 10 mils *The millage rate would be expressed as .010 (.001 x 10) *The amount of tax would be calculated as $1000 x .010 = $10.00 *10 mils generates $10 of tax for each $1000 of taxable value.

The calculation of taxes on your home might look like this, depending on the value of your home and the taxing district you live in. This is a hypothetical example:

Assessed value$ 50,000
Homestead Exemption25,000
Taxable value25,000
Tax Rate(20 mils) x .020
Tax amount$ 500.00

Millage rates are set each year during the budget hearings held by each of the taxing authorities. Two public hearings are held each year, usually July through September, at which time budgets and tax rates are set. The meetings are advertised and are open to the public.
